How Custom Embroidery Machines Work
At the heart of Stitching Perfection: 4 Ways To Create Custom Patches On Your Embroidery Machine is the embroidery machine, a sophisticated device that uses a combination of threads, needles, and computer-controlled systems to create intricate designs.
The process of creating a custom patch involves several steps, including designing the design, selecting the thread colors, and loading the embroidery program onto the machine.

Designing Your Custom Patch
The first step in creating a custom patch is designing the design. This can involve using computer software or sketching out the design by hand.
Some popular design elements to consider when creating a custom patch include:
- Logos and branding elements.
- Images and graphics.
- Text and quotes.
- Abstract designs and patterns.
Selecting Thread Colors and Types
Once you have your design, it's time to choose the thread colors and types that will bring it to life.
Here are some factors to consider when selecting thread colors:
- The color scheme of your brand or design.
- The type of fabric you're using.
- The level of detail in your design.
